2006 Citizen Science Conference
Announced
Shawn Carlson, Executive Director of the
Society for Amateur Scientists, has announced that the 2006
Citizen Science Conference will be held in Providence, Rhode
Island, from August 24 (Thursday) through August 27 (Sunday).
Those who wish to present a paper at the meeting should send
an abstract here.
Shawn reports, "As always, we will
have a nifty day event on Thursday, meetings Friday and Saturday,
a lecture Friday evening and an awards banquet on Saturday
evening. Sunday morning will be a poster session."
The meeting will be held at the Providence
Marriott Downtown Hotel. The cost of registration for
the four day event will be $180. Single day registration will
be $90, and registration for only the poster session will
be $60.
